The Toronto Blue Jays (43-37, third in the AL East) take on the Boston Red Sox (40-42, fourth in the AL East) in MLB action.
The game is scheduled for Friday, June 27, 2025, at 6:10 PM EDT in Boston.
The Blue Jays are expected to send Jose Berrios (3-3, 3.51 ERA, 1.24 WHIP, 81 strikeouts) to the mound.
For the Red Sox, Brayan Bello (3-2, 3.31 ERA, 1.41 WHIP, 51 strikeouts) is the projected starter.
Blue Jays -113, Red Sox -106.
The over/under for the game is set at 8 1/2 runs.
The Boston Red Sox will look to continue a five-game home winning streak as they host the Toronto Blue Jays.
Boston holds a 22-17 record in home games this season, with an overall record of 40-42. The Red Sox rank sixth in the AL with 98 total home runs, averaging 1.2 per game.
Toronto has an 18-21 record on the road and is 43-37 overall. The Blue Jays have performed well when getting hits, holding a 32-15 record in games where they record eight or more hits.
This is the eighth meeting between the teams this season, with the Blue Jays currently leading the season series 5-2.
Wilyer Abreu leads the Red Sox offense with 13 home runs and a .465 slugging percentage.
Trevor Story has contributed recently, going 8 for 37 with two home runs and six RBI over Boston's last 10 games.
For the Blue Jays, Vladimir Guerrero Jr. has hit 16 doubles and 11 home runs.
Ernie Clement has been hot in Toronto's last 10 games, going 15 for 39 with two doubles.
In their last 10 games, the Red Sox have gone 4-6 with a .191 batting average and a 3.60 ERA, being outscored by 13 runs.
The Blue Jays have a 5-5 record in their last 10 games, posting a .263 batting average and a 4.35 ERA, while outscoring their opponents by four runs.
Red Sox injuries: Hunter Dobbins (elbow), Jordan Hicks (toe), Josh Winckowski (elbow), Nick Burdi (knee), Justin Slaten (shoulder), Liam Hendriks (hip), Alex Bregman (quadricep), Triston Casas (knee), Masataka Yoshida (shoulder), Kutter Crawford (knee), Tanner Houck (flexor), Chris Murphy (elbow), Patrick Sandoval (elbow).
Blue Jays injuries: Vladimir Guerrero Jr. (forerm), Bowden Francis (shoulder), Daulton Varsho (hamstring), Anthony Santander (shoulder), Yimi Garcia (shoulder), Ryan Burr (shoulder), Alek Manoah (elbow), Angel Bastardo (elbow).
